Al Madaribah Wa Al Arah District (Al Madaribah Wa Al Arah)
Al Madaribah Wa Al Arah District is the westernmost and southernmost of the 15 districts of the Lahij Governorate, Yemen. With an area of 1848.50 km2, it is also the largest of all districts within the governorate. As of the census of population on 2004-12-16, the district had a population of 45,808 inhabitants.

Yemen (ٱلْيَمَن), officially the Republic of Yemen, is a country in Western Asia.

It is situated on the southern end of the Arabian Peninsula, and borders Arabia to the north and Oman to the northeast and shares maritime borders with Eritrea, Djibouti and Somalia. Yemen is the second-largest Arab sovereign state in the Arabian Peninsula, occupying 555,000 km2, with a coastline stretching about 2000 km. Its constitutionally stated capital, and largest city, is Sanaa. As of 2023, Yemen has an estimated population of 34.2 million.
